How To Fix RMSL136 - System could not read description of ingredient &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RMSL - Labeling Application Messages

  • Message number: 136

  • Message text: System could not read description of ingredient &1

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message RMSL136 - System could not read description of ingredient &1 ?

    The SAP error message RMSL136, which states "System could not read description of ingredient &1," typically occurs in the context of the Recipe Management or Product Lifecycle Management modules. This error indicates that the system is unable to retrieve the description for a specific ingredient, which is represented by the placeholder "&1".

    Causes:

    1. Missing Master Data: The ingredient may not have been properly defined in the system, or the master data for the ingredient is incomplete or missing.
    2.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data, such as incorrect or missing entries in the relevant tables.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the ingredient's description.
    4. Technical Issues: There could be a technical issue with the database or the SAP system itself that is preventing the retrieval of the ingredient description.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Master Data:

      • Verify that the ingredient exists in the system. You can do this by navigating to the relevant master data transaction (e.g., MM01 for material master).
      • Ensure that the ingredient has a valid description and that all required fields are filled out.
    2. Data Consistency Check:

      • Run consistency checks on the relevant master data to identify any discrepancies or missing information.
      • Use transaction codes like SE11 to check the database tables related to ingredients.
    3. Authorization Check:

      •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to view the ingredient's details. This can be checked with the help of your SAP security team.
    4. Technical Troubleshooting:

      • If the issue persists, check for any system errors or logs that might indicate a technical problem. You can use transaction codes like SM21 (System Log) or ST22 (Dump Analysis) to investigate further.
      • If necessary, consult with your SAP Basis team to ensure that the system is functioning correctly.
    5. Recreate the Ingredient:

      • If the ingredient is corrupted or has missing data, consider deleting and recreating it, ensuring that all necessary information is provided.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as MM01 (Create Material), MM02 (Change Material), and MM03 (Display Material) for managing ingredient master data.
    • S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this specific error or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
    • Documentation: Review SAP documentation related to Recipe Management or Product Lifecycle Management for best practices in managing ingredients and recipes.
